The acquisition will allow DRG to drive business in the US, while continuing to build its presence in Ireland and Europe.
In order to support expansion into the US market, the deal is expected to create 20 new jobs in Ireland, adding to the 16 existing employees in DRG’s Dublin offices.
DRG shareholders include the founders and management team, Pageant Holdings and Enterprise Ireland. Take 5 is backed by New York-based private equity firm Kinderhook Industries. DRG CEO, Colm Grealy, joins the board of directors of Take 5.
DRG plans to sell a range of mobile services in the US including apps, mobile websites, location-based services, mobile couponing, QR codes and mobile strategies.
Clients of DRG in Ireland include RTÉ, BBC and Communicorp. From its new Florida offices DRG will have access to over 30 sales people who currently work with some of America’s Fortune 500 companies, including Disney, Citibank, Procter & Gamble and various insurance firms.
